free range thinking

Thinking that is without boundaries. Coming up with ideas that are innovative, disruptive and would challenge the status quo.
If not for free range thinking we wouldn't enjoy many of the technological advancements that have become part of our everyday lives, e.g. cell phones, satellite communications, internet.
